UFR Trademark

Serial Number: 99919388

UFR is a trademark filed by Universal Field Robots Pty Ltd on July 2, 2026. The trademark is classified under Class 7 (Machinery), Class 9 (Computers & Electronics), Class 12 (Vehicles). The application is currently pending registration.
